Ford class, the \u201eUSS Enterprise\u201c (CVN-80), has been postponed until March 2031. <\/strong>The fourth ship in the class, the \u201eUSS Doris Miller\u201c (CVN-81), is now not due to be handed over to the Navy until February 2034, which is also two years later than previously planned.<\/p>\n<p>The Navy cites limited production capacity at Newport News Shipbuilding as the main reason for this. The Huntington Ingalls Industries shipyard is still the only company in the United States that builds nuclear-powered aircraft carriers. According to the Navy, space bottlenecks at the shipyard are currently hampering parallel module production for the fourth carrier. In addition, there are ongoing supply chain problems and delays in the construction of the \u201eUSS Enterprise\u201c, which are now having an impact on the follow-up programme. Image: HII Newport News Shipbuilding<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>This development illustrates the ongoing structural challenges facing the Ford class. While the last Nimitz-class carrier, the \u201eUSS George H.W. Bush\u201c, was completed in less than six years from keel laying to commissioning, the construction times for the new class are increasing significantly. The \u201eUSS John F. Kennedy\u201c (CVN-79), which is now scheduled for commissioning in March 2027, will take almost twelve years to build.<\/p>\n<p>This has immediate consequences for the US Navy. Congress stipulates a fleet of at least eleven aircraft carriers. In order to comply with this requirement, the \u201eUSS Nimitz\u201c, which was originally scheduled for decommissioning, will remain in active service for longer. The replacement of other older units of the class of the same name is also likely to be delayed accordingly.<\/p>\n<p>Newport News refers to the extensive modernisation of its infrastructure. The construction dock was already converted at the end of 2024 so that two girders can be installed in parallel for the first time. However, the latest postponements show that these measures have not yet been able to eliminate the bottlenecks.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_55366\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-55366\" style=\"width: 300px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><a href=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ain.jpg\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-55366 size-medium\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-300x292.jpg\" alt=\"US war poster with Doris Miller, 1943. graphic: The U.S. National Archives, Public domain\" width=\"300\" height=\"292\" srcset=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-300x292.jpg 300w, \/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-1024x995.jpg 1024w, \/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-768x746.jpg 768w, \/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-1536x1493.jpg 1536w, \/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ain-12x12.jpg 12w, \/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/US-Kriegsplakat-mit-Doris-Miller-1943_Grafik_The-US-National-Archives-Public-domain.jpg 1920w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-55366\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">US war poster with Doris Miller, 1943. graphic: The U.S. National Archives, Public domain<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<figure id=\"attachment_55365\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-55365\" style=\"width: 188px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><a href=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/B3_Namensgeber-fuer-CVN-81-Doris-Miller_Bild_US-Navy.jpg\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-55365 size-medium\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/B3_Namensgeber-fuer-CVN-81-Doris-Miller_Bild_US-Navy-188x300.jpg\" alt=\"CVN-81 is named after Doris Miller, who was awarded the Navy Cross for his service in the attack on Pearl Harbor.
